            Just a foreach loop on the array
static boolean hasEmpty(String[] values){
    for(String elt : values)
        if(elt.isEmpty())
            return true;
    return false;
}
If you want to add a not only whitespace string use
if (elt.isEmpty() || elt.isBlank()) {
